Good see reply on this thread. Honda Shine is good in style, milage in 125cc, with some limitations.

Problems
Prob 1 :We cannot shift gears smoothly.

2. There was no chance to go over 90kmph

3.Recently I changed chains pocket they call it as. Complete chain set I think. Still I am getting chain sound.

4. The other problem is that acid leak from the battery ruins the look of covers near engine. Find the attached photo of the same.

Advantages

1. Good grip. Even though the road is slippery, we can ride shine confortably.
2. My bike model is Oct 2008.Strong parts.
3. Milage I observed now is 55 on hyd roads.(i.e after 3 years)
4. Stylish

Quote:
Originally Posted by KRR View Post
3.Recently I changed chains pocket they call it as. Complete chain set I think. Still I am getting chain sound.
Chain noise is due to lack of lubrication,Lube the chain with SAE90 Grade oil or Bearing grease,it will reduce the chain noise.

Quote:
4. The other problem is that acid leak from the battery ruins the look of covers near engine.
Isn't there a tube? A long tube for overflow to drain out? Check it.

Quote:
Originally Posted by KRR View Post
Recently 10 days back bike was serviced, in front of me only it was greased. Also I asked to tight the chain.I will try lubricating the chain.
There should be a slack of 15-20mm after tighting the chain,an over tight chainwill make sounds and will make the sprocket wear out faster,make sure about that.

Quote:
Sound arises when gear shift, near speed brakers, glitches. Not continuosly.
Make sure that the chain is not rubbing against the chain guard or something.
